How do you know they were living in Norton Lindsey (a village in Warwickshire for those of you who, like me, thought the Lindsey bit might mean Lincolnshire) at the time of the 1851 census, 30 March 1851?
Have you 'walked' through village in the 1851 census, i.e. looked at the images, to see if they have been mis-indexed, or perhaps even have been given the wrong surname? (Wouldn't be the first example of an enumerator beginning with say the father and mother of one family and ending with the kids of another. ) Census refs for the village begin HO107/2072 folio 114 page 1 and end folio 118 page 9.
We need a few more details such as Wiliam and Mary Anne's ages, any known children, whether you've found them in 1841/1861, and if the latter where they said they were born.

That's interesting because according to the Genuki list of registration districts Harwick Union doesn't exist. The nearest name-wise is Harwich, but that's (a)in Essex and (b) only existed between 1939 and 1957.
FreeBMD shows James William and Elizabeth Ann's birth registrations in Warwick registration district.
I've submitted an error report for both entries to the GRO.
